Each location Pokémon Colosseum and Pokémon XD: Gale of Darkness has its own identification number used internally by the game, mostly to display where a Pokémon was caught. They are enumerated here, in order.
As none of the locations in Orre correspond to locations in Kanto or Hoenn, Pokémon traded to any of the Generation III handheld games will display "met in a trade" as their captured location. When transferred to Generation IV, Pokémon will, like with Pokémon caught in the handheld games, use the game identifier to mark the Pokémon as being from a "Distant land", rather than "Orre".
If an XD Pokémon is traded to Colosseum, it will always display the captured location as "Mt. Battle", even if it was captured in a location that appears in Colosseum. Likewise, a Colosseum Pokémon will be identified in XD as being from a "Distant land", even though it was captured in the same region. This is because the games do not understand each other's index number lists.
